Quick Sourcing Note

XL-J1608SURC-06 from XINGLIGHT is a red SMD chip LED in the LED category. It uses a compact 1608 SMD package measuring 1.6 x 0.8 x 0.6 mm with transparent/water-clear colloid. At IF=20 mA and Ta=25°C, the device provides 80 to 210 mcd luminous intensity, 615 to 630 nm dominant wavelength, 625 nm typical peak wavelength, and 1.9 to 2.1 V forward voltage. The LED supports a 120° typical viewing angle, MSL 3 handling, 30 mA maximum continuous forward current, and 60 mW maximum power dissipation.

Product Overview

XL-J1608SURC-06 is a XINGLIGHT red SMD chip LED supplied in a 1608 package with 1.6 x 0.8 x 0.6 mm outline dimensions. The luminous color is red, and the package uses a transparent/water-clear colloid structure.

Electrical and optical parameters are specified at IF=20 mA and Ta=25°C, including 80 to 210 mcd luminous intensity, 615 to 630 nm dominant wavelength, 625 nm typical peak wavelength, 1.9 to 2.1 V forward voltage, 20 nm typical half wave width, and 120° typical viewing angle. Absolute maximum ratings include 60 mW power dissipation, 30 mA continuous forward current, 80 mA peak forward current under pulse conditions, and 5 V maximum reverse voltage.

Assembly guidance includes MSL 3 handling, up to two reflow soldering cycles, recommended maximum welding temperature of 240±5°C for 6 s, and hand soldering below 300°C for less than 3 s per terminal. These characteristics support compact red indication and display functions using a small SMD LED footprint.

FAQ

What package size does XL-J1608SURC-06 use?

XL-J1608SURC-06 uses a 1608 SMD package with outline dimensions of 1.6 x 0.8 x 0.6 mm, specified as length, width, and height in the manufacturer technical datasheet.

What are the main optical ratings at 20 mA?

At IF=20 mA and Ta=25°C, the LED is specified for 80 to 210 mcd luminous intensity, 615 to 630 nm dominant wavelength, 625 nm typical peak wavelength, and 120° typical viewing angle.

What forward voltage range is specified for this red LED?

The forward voltage range is 1.9 to 2.1 V at IF=20 mA and Ta=25°C. The datasheet also lists voltage grades from M12-8 through M13-2 covering 1.9 to 2.1 V.

What soldering limits apply to XL-J1608SURC-06?

The datasheet lists a lead soldering limit of 260°C for up to 6 s and recommends maximum welding at 240±5°C for 6 s. Hand soldering is limited to below 300°C for less than 3 s per terminal, one time only.

How should opened packages be stored before soldering?

After opening the package, storage should be at <=30°C and <40% RH, with soldering completed within 168 hours. If storage time is exceeded or the moisture absorbent material fades, baking is specified at 60±5°C for 24 hours.
